Providing a rescue, care, and
rehabilitation service and facility aiming
releasing back into the wild whenever
possible. The trustees are pleased to
report successfully fulfilling this activity
attending emergency call outs, providing
appropriate advice to members of the
public, liaising and transport with a
wildlife hospital where needed, including
overnight rehabilitation and care etc. The
charity has successfully recruited new
volunteers and has involved itself to
inform and educate both in the press
and social media.

Para 1.20 Answered and attended to call outs for
wildlife in need, returning to the wild
without unwilding where possible,
rescued for treatment and rehabilitation
if not always with the sole aim of
returning to the wild. Ensuring no further
suffering where this was not possible.
Working with the member of public who
contacted us initially being mindful of
the stress and upset such incidents
cause, allaying fears where possible,
affording as speedy a response as
possible, giving care and treatment
advice when apposite, and when
necessary explaining ending suffering
outcomes.
A major achievement has been
managing the growth that our growing
good reputation incurred and
recruitment of new volunteers with this
growth in demand expected to continue
next year.
